Description:
This two-toned print depicts protesters carrying posters protesting apartheid. The posters are large and read: [APARTHEID IS: / EXPLOITATION, / RACISM-GENOCIDE] and [THE SASO 9 / THE SWAPO 6 / THE NUSAS 2 / AND AL APARTHEID PRISONERS / PAN AFRICAN STUDENTS ORG. IN THE AMERICAS / WITH (ILLEGIBLE) & FASCISM]. The photograph is credited to [Guardian photo: George Cohen]. The photograph is printed on white printer paper. The back of the page is blank.
